Neptunazurea is a genus of sea slugs, dorid nudibranchs, shell-less marine gastropod mollusks in the in family Chromodorididae[2].

Neptunazurea was established after analysis of several small blue species previously placed in Felimare. There had never been a clear set of diagnostics for Felimare, as the genus was re-established as a result of molecular phylogenetic analysis only; morphological features were not taken into account. The species then included in Felimare (placed previously in Hypselodoris and Mexichromis) shared neither external and internal anatomies nor reproductive morphologies[1].

In Ribeiro et al. (2025)[1], a study was done re-investigating Felimare with special focus on the blue, smaller species of the Eastern Pacific and Atlantic oceans. Both molecular and morphological analyses performed, and a distinct, consistent set of diagnostic material was able to be established. Thus, Neptunazurea was proposed as a new genus within Chromodorididae.
